How Sound and Light Control Sensor Lamps Work

The core of sound and light control sensor lamps lies in their ability to detect and interpret environmental cues. Here's a breakdown of how these lamps function: 1. Sound Detection: Microphones embedded in the lamp's design pick up ambient sounds. The sensitivity of these microphones can be adjusted to cater to different environments. 2. Light Detection: Light sensors, often in the form of photodiodes or LDRs (Light-Dependent Resistors), measure the ambient light levels. 3. Processing Unit: The collected data from the sound and light sensors is processed by a microcontroller or a similar processing unit. 4. Adjustment Mechanism: Based on the processed data, the lamp adjusts its brightness and, in some cases, the color temperature of the light. This seamless integration of sound and light detection allows the lamp to provide a customized lighting experience that adapts to the user's needs and the environment.

Benefits of Sound and Light Control Sensor Lamps

The adoption of sound and light control sensor lamps offers several advantages: 1. Energy Efficiency: By automatically adjusting the brightness, these lamps can significantly reduce energy consumption compared to traditional lighting. 2. Comfort and Convenience: The ability to adjust the light intensity based on ambient conditions ensures a comfortable environment for the user. 3. Customization: Users can set specific preferences for their lighting experience, such as softer light during bedtime or brighter light for reading. 4. Integration with Smart Home Systems: Sound and light control sensor lamps can be integrated with smart home systems, allowing for centralized control and automation.
